E-Learning for On-Site Staff: Part 4

During these challenging times where face-to-face training is often discouraged, e-learning is a practical and enjoyable training solution for your site staff. 

Each week over the next couple of months, we will shine a spotlight on an e-learning course that your estate manager, concierge, cleaner or on-site handyman can take in their own time.

The courses, which are health and safety based, can be taken on their laptop, tablet or even smartphone. Once your member of on-site staff has absorbed the course material, they will be presented with an on-line assessment to prove that they have grasped the subject. If they don’t pass first time, they can take the course again and re-sit the assessment. You will have proof of their learning and assessment, and they will have a certificate to keep for their own records.

Key benefits of e-learning:

  • Courses can be taken when it’s convenient for the member of staff.

  • They are a highly efficient way to learn. E-learning courses are typically 45 minutes including the assessment.

  • They are very cost effective – from as little as £60 per course per member of staff.

  • Helps to discharge your obligations as the building manager.

  • Your clients’ health, safety and welfare obligations towards their employees are fulfilled.

Week 4: Health & Safety Awareness

This course may provide to be a lifesaver. It takes 25 mins to take, including self-assessment at the end for your member of site staff to demonstrate their adequate understanding of the course material.

Thousands of workers are injured on the job every year. Some of these injuries are serious and even fatal. This course will help your on-site staff continue their ongoing learning, and reinforce key health and safety messages. The course will provide your estate manager, concierge, caretaker or cleaner with tips and resources for reducing risk and avoiding these on-the-job injuries.
